Nepal, April 12 -- Minister for Education, Science and Technology Sasmit Pokharel has declared total assets worth over Rs 241.6 million, according to property details made public by the Office of the Prime Minister and Council of Ministers on Sunday.

The disclosed assets include land and property, vehicles, gold and silver, bank deposits, and share investments in various companies.

According to the statement, Pokharel owns a two-and-a-half-storey house in Kathmandu valued at Rs 40 million. He also owns six aana of land in Mulpani worth Rs 50 million and one kattha of land in Morang valued at Rs 10 million.
